求助,负载跑100%,CPU,内存,IO都正常
时间 : 2024-03-19 05:37:03声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性
最佳答案
当负载跑到100%,但是CPU、内存和IO都正常的情况下,可能存在以下几种可能原因:
1. **负载指标不准确**:需要确认负载指标的准确性。有时候系统的负载指标可能存在问题,导致显示错误的信息。可以尝试使用其他监控工具进行验证。
2. **进程占用**:可能是某个进程占用了全部的负载,但是没有反映在CPU、内存、IO等指标上。可以通过查看系统的进程列表,找出是否有某个进程异常占用资源。
3. **IO等待**:另外,负载高但IO正常可能是因为系统存在IO等待。即使IO正常,但是如果有大量的IO等待,也会导致系统负载升高。可以通过查看系统的IO状态,了解是否存在IO等待的情况。
4. **网络负载**:还有可能是由于网络负载导致系统负载升高。虽然CPU、内存、IO等指标正常,但是如果网络负载很高,也会影响系统的整体性能。可以通过查看网络流量以及网络连接等信息,了解是否存在网络负载过高的情况。
综上所述,当负载达到100%但是CPU、内存、IO都正常的情况下,需要对系统的各个方面进行全面的排查,找出可能的原因并加以解决。希望以上信息对您有所帮助。
其他答案
当我们遇到负载跑到100%但是CPU、内存、IO都正常的情况时,通常可以考虑以下几个可能的原因和解决方法。
可能是由于系统中某个进程或者任务占用了大量的计算资源,导致整体负载达到100%。这时候我们可以通过系统监控工具查看当前运行的进程,找出哪个进程占用了过多的资源,并对其进行优化或者关闭,从而降低系统负载。
可能是系统中存在某个耗时长、资源占用大的任务正在运行,导致系统负载升高。在这种情况下,我们可以考虑将该任务调度到非高峰时段运行,或者对该任务进行优化,减少其资源占用,从而降低系统负载。
另外,还有可能是系统配置不合理或者硬件故障引起的负载过高。可以检查系统配置是否合理,比如是否开启了过多的服务或者应用程序,是否进行了适当的性能调优等。同时,也可以检查硬件是否存在故障,比如硬盘IO异常、内存损坏等,及时修复或更换故障硬件,以恢复系统的正常运行。
当负载达到100%但是CPU、内存、IO都正常时,需要通过分析系统运行情况和硬件状态,找出引起负载过高的原因,并采取相应的措施进行解决,以确保系统的稳定和高效运行。
https/SSL证书广告优选IDC>>
推荐主题模板更多>>
推荐文章